Track action scene, Car Number 196, the prototype Lotus VII, Edward Lewis, driver (helmet, seated).

  • Race Data Edward Lewis driving Car Number 196, the prototype Lotus VII, ran the second fastest time of the Sports Cars 1101 to 1500cc class at 29.72 seconds for the standing start kilometer race.
